Method for preparing calcium sulfate whisker through recrystallization

The invention discloses a method for preparing a calcium sulfate whisker through recrystallization. The method is characterized in that the method comprises the steps of (1), conducting program control on heating and dissolution courses: putting a raw material with a main ingredient of calcium sulfate into a sulphuric acid solution for stirring, heating simultaneously, heating a mixture to 60-95 DEG C at a certain rate with the adoption of the program control, dissolving for 20min-1h, (2), conducting the program control on cooling and recrystallization courses: using the program control to cool a suspension obtained by dissolution to 10-30 DEG C, ageing for 20min-2h, (3), conducting separating and washing courses: conducting solid-liquid separation on the suspension, washing a separated solid-phase product, and (4), conducting a drying course: drying the washed solid-phase product at a certain temperature, and obtaining the calcium sulphate dihydrate whisker. The calcium sulfate whisker is prepared by utilizing a recrystallization principle under an ordinary-pressure mild condition, and a relatively economical technological approach can be provided for the resource utilization of industrial by-products such as desulfurization gypsum and phosphogypsum.

The invention relates to a waterflood simulation recovery ratio test method considering energy flow in a low-permeability reservoir. The method is completed by means of a core displacement device. Thedevice is composed of a confining pressure pump, a core holder, a back pressure pump, a simulated oil intermediate container, a formation water intermediate container and the like. The method comprises the following steps that (1), simulated oil is prepared, and the volume factor B0 of the simulated oil is tested; (2), a plurality of blocks cores containing crack plungers are selected, and the diameter Di, the length Li, the mass Mi1 and the permeability Ki of the cores are tested; (3), the core bound water saturation is established; (4), the cores are saturated with the simulated oil; (5), the recovery ratio R0 of the failure development simulated oil is calculated; (6), the simulated oil intermediate container is opened, far-well zone energy flow is simulated, and a first round of waterflood simulation oil recovery cumulative recovery ratio R1 is obtained; and (7), the sixth step is repeated, and the i-th round of waterflood simulation oil recovery cumulative recovery ratio Ri is obtained. The method is reliable in principle, simple and applicable, can accurately evaluate the waterflood simulation recovery ratio under a real reservoir condition and has a wide market applicationprospect.

Method for measuring gas well critical liquid-carrying flow

The invention belongs to the technical field of gas production technologies in oil and gas fields, and particular relates to a method for measuring gas well critical liquid-carrying flow. The method includes the steps that gas well history data are searched for to obtain the oil pipe diameter D; gas well gas is sampled to measure gas components, and then the relative density gamma of the gas relative to air is calculated; bottom hole pressure Pm and temperature T are measured, and a corresponding compressibility factor is calculated through a iterative method according to the bottom hole pressure Pm and the temperature T; the critical liquid-carrying flow is calculated by using the oil pipe diameter D, the relative density gamma of the gas, the pressure Pm, the temperature T and the corresponding compressibility factor. According to the method for measuring the gas well critical liquid-carrying flow, a kinetic energy factor is cited and combined with practical production data of a Sulige gas field to determine a critical liquid-carrying flow formula, and a simpler and more reliable method is provided for determining the critical liquid-carrying flow of the Sulige gas field. The principle is reliable, and compared with an existing critical liquid-carrying flow model, the method fits the practical situation of the Sulige gas field better.

Digital-core-based method and digital-core-based device for acquiring electrical parameters of rocks

The invention discloses a digital-core-based method and a digital-core-based device for acquiring electrical parameters of rocks. The method includes the following steps: 1) performing CT scanning oncore samples, acquiring greyscale images of the core samples and constructing three-dimensional digital cores; 2) extracting pore radius distribution of the cores on the basis of the three-dimensionaldigital cores; 3) calculating the communication porosity in the X, Y and Z directions on the basis of the three-dimensional digital cores; 4) representing fluid distribution in pore space on the basis of the core pore radius distribution and the communication porosity; 5) calculating tortuosity of the pore space on the basis of the fluid distribution in the communicated pore space; 6) calculatingformation factor values of formation water during complete saturation; 7) calculating resistance enlargement coefficients under different water saturation degrees. By the method and the device, the difficulty in acquiring the electrical parameters of the rocks due to failure to displace rocks with core displacement difficulty, such as compact sandstone, can be solved.

Method of separating surface-related multiples of different orders in seismic exploration data

The invention belongs to the technical field of seismic exploration data processing, and relates to a method of separating surface-related multiples of different orders in seismic exploration data. The problem that surface-related multiples of different orders cannot be separated directly in seismic exploration data processing is solved. Effective use of surface-related multiples of different orders is realized. The method combines the weighted cross-correlation idea of focus transformation and the weighted convolution idea of SRME (Surface-Related Multiple Elimination). Firstly, primaries are separated from the overall surface-related multiples of different orders through SRME; secondly, order reduction of the surface-related multiples of different orders is realized through forward focus transformation; thirdly, a quasi-seismic record is extracted through non-stationary matched filtering; fourthly, quasi-primaries in the quasi-seismic record are extracted through SRME; and finally, the order of the quasi-primaries is increased through reverse focus transformation, the quasi-primaries are returned to an original data field, and separated surface-related multiples of different orders are acquired. A reasonable and effective method of separating surface-related multiples of different orders is put forward systematically to realize effective separation of surface-related multiples of different orders. The method has the advantages of reliable principle, clear technical process, and wide application scope.

Method for obtaining surface contact ratio of acid etching fracture by experiment measure

The invention discloses a method for obtaining the surface contact ratio of an acid etching fracture by an experiment measure. The method comprises the following steps of: (A) respectively cutting white paper and carbon paper which have the same surface shape and size as an original rock plate; (B) sequentially putting the white paper, the carbon paper and the rock plate subjected to acid etching on a smooth steel plate; then putting a rigid press head onto the rock plate; exerting preset pressure on the rigid press head; and performing stabilization for one minute; (C) unloading the pressure (a mark of the contact area between the rough surface of the rock plate and the steel plate is left on the white paper by carbon paper); (D) dividing the total pixel of the whole paper by the pixel of the mark part to obtain the contact ratio between the rock plate and the steel plate; and (E) multiplying the contact ratio by 20.25 to obtain the contact ratio of the two rock plate surfaces corresponding to the rock plate under the mutual contact condition. The method has the advantages that the principle is reliable; the operation is simple and convenient; and the accurate contact ratio data can be provided for the study of the acid etching crack flow guide capability.

Experimental test method of competitive dissolution of CO<2> in oil-water mixture system

The invention discloses an experimental test method of competitive dissolution of CO<2> in an oil-water mixture system. The experimental test method of competitive dissolution of CO<2> in the oil-water mixture system comprises the steps of: configuring a crude oil sample and a formation water sample, wherein injected gas is industrial CO<2> gas; injecting the formation water sample, an oil sampleand the CO<2> gas in a sample preparation device; discharging the oil sample, recording the volume of crude oil discharged from a separator and the volume of CO<2> in a gasometer, and calculating thegas-oil ratio after CO<2> is dissolved by the crude oil; recording the volume of formation water discharged from the separator and the volume of CO<2> in the gasometer, and calculating the gas-water ratio after CO<2> is dissolved in water phase; and, gradually increasing displacement pressure, repeating the step, so that the volume of dissolved CO<2> in the crude oil and the formation water samplein series of pressure conditions is obtained, and furthermore, calculating the dissolved CO<2> gas-water ratio GWR in the water phase and the dissolved CO<2> gas-oil ratio GOR in the oil phasein each pressure condition. The experimental test method disclosed by the invention is reliable in principle, simple and applicative, can precisely evaluate and compare the dissolving condition when CO<2> is contacted with the crude oil and the formation water at the same time in a true reservoir condition, and has wide market application prospect.
